模板语法demo1.hrml1.1 插值 1.1.1 文本 {{msg}} 1.1.2 html 使用v-html指令用于输出html代码 1.1.3 属性 HTML属性中的值应使用v-bind指令 1.1.4 表达式 Vue提供了完全的JavaScript表达式支持 {{str.substr(0,6).toUpperCase()}} {{ number + 1 }} {{ ok ? ‘YES’
转载
2024-09-26 10:23:14
46阅读
vue学习简记(一)监视属性监视属性和计算属性的区别绑定样式的写法条件渲染Vue中的数据监视 监视属性在vue中配置watch实现监视,当被监视的属性变化时, 回调函数自动调用, 进行相关操作监视属性的基本写法watch: {
//正常写法
isHot: {
// immediate:true, //初始化时让handler调用一下
转载
2024-05-15 05:50:48
39阅读
文章目录定义要监听的属性定义 watch修改监听的属性值监听数组变化监听对象变化监听计算属性变化监听事件变化监听路由变化 在 Vue 中,可以使用 watch/$watch 方法监听数据、计算属性、事件和路由的变化,从而实现数据绑定、事件监听和路由控制等功能。需要根据实际情况选择合适的监听方式,避免过度监听或监听不必要的属性,从而提高应用性能和用户体验。 定义要监听的属性定义要监听的属性: “
转载
2024-02-24 17:54:46
87阅读
1.官方解释 Vuex是一个专为Vue.js应用程序开发的状态管理模式。然后Vuex里面有五个特别重要的属性,分别是state,mutations,actions,getters,modules。 2.state 放置状态相关的信息,vue是使用单一状态树的,也就是单一数据源,也就是说我们的stat ...
转载
2021-08-28 09:26:00
148阅读
2评论
##概念 在Vue中实现集中式状态(数据)管理的一个Vue插件,对vue应用中多个组件的共享状态进行集中式的管理(读/写),也是一种组件间通信的方式,且适用于任意组件间通信。 ##何时使用? 多个组件需要共享数据时 ##环境搭建 1.创建文件:src/store/index.js //引入Vue核心 ...
转载
2021-10-15 16:51:00
205阅读
2评论
Vuex 提出了单一状态树Single Source of Truth,亦可译为单一数据源。 Vuex 使用单一状态树来管理应用层级的全部状态mutation# Payload: 传递参数Vuex 要求mutation中方法必须是同步的devtools 可捕获mutation快照 异步操作时,devtools无法实时跟踪mutationAction 作用于异步操作通过dispatch调用函数...
原创
2022-03-05 21:38:12
180阅读
文章目录监听属性深度监听监听属性和计算属性使用监听属性实现使用计算属性实现 监听属性监听的属性发生变化时,会自动调用回调函数,执行相关操作。监听属性有两种写法,如下:
new Vue()中传入watch配置。通过vm.$watch进行监听。看个具体的例子。在new Vue()中传入watch配置。<body>
<div id="root">
<
转载
2024-05-17 04:33:03
47阅读
Vue中可以使用监听器监听属性的变化,并根据属性变化作出响应。但一旦涉及到复杂数据的监听(如Object,但数组一般不需要,因为Vue针对数组做了特殊处理)时就比较复杂了,本文解释了使用watch监听属性变化的方法,包括复杂数据。基本用法Vue watch最重要的使用场景是根据某属性的变化执行某些业务逻辑:<template>
<input type="number" v-m
转载
2024-04-02 14:47:58
73阅读
监听属性(watch):vue数据是响应式数据,指的是数据可以进行跟踪和监听。1.比较常用的使用方法watch:{
// 属性是要监听变化的数据,属性值是监听函数
msg:function(newValue,oldValue){
console.log(newValue); // 变化之后的值
转载
2024-04-04 19:10:31
240阅读
Vuex 官方文档:https://vuex.vuejs.org/zh/guide/ Vuex是一个专门为Vue.js应用程序开发的状态管理模式, 它采用集中式存储管理所有组件的公共状态, 并以相应的规则保证状态以一种可预测的方式发生变化. Vuex核心 state:存放数据状态 mutations
转载
2020-10-12 17:08:00
144阅读
2评论
Vuex的核心是store(仓库)。store基本上是一个容器,包含应用中绝大部分state, mutation, action, getters等。const store = new Vuex.Store({ state: {
原创
2022-06-27 11:17:10
277阅读
1.安装vuex模块npm i vuex --save-dev//main.js文件import Vue from 'vue'import store from './store'import vuex from './vuex.vue'new Vue({ el:'#app', store, render:xx=>xx(vuex)})// store...
原创
2022-10-14 16:10:49
84阅读
vuex:状态管理模块1.使用const moduleA = new Vuex.Store({// 保存数据state:{ 在任何组件可以通过KaTeX parse error: Expected 'EOF', got '}' at position 82: …,10,20] }̲, // 修改s…store.commit(‘incr...
原创
2021-04-29 13:57:10
225阅读
vue & vuex
转载
2019-05-10 14:12:00
81阅读
【代码】vue vuex getters。
原创
2023-09-23 11:14:44
127阅读
【代码】vue vuex mapMutation。
原创
2023-09-23 11:16:01
118阅读
一、什么是Vuex Vuex 是一个专为 Vue.js 应用程序开发的状态管理模式。它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。 状态,其实指的是实例之间的共享数据,Vuex是管理应用中不同Vue实例之间数据共享的工具。 下图是Vuex官方提供的对于状
转载
2020-12-08 14:57:00
167阅读
2评论
【前言】本博客系统的讲诉了Vuex的安装、搭建。以及Actions、Mutations、State、Getters的使用,为什么使用mapState、mapGetters以及一些细节的解释Vuex原理讲解 编辑Actions:词义是 动作行为Mutations:词义是加工、维护State:词义是 状态和数据Dispatch:词义是派遣、发出Commit:提交Render: 渲
推荐
原创
2022-10-30 16:54:14
427阅读
vuex是用来保存一个全局的数据,可以与多个组件进行绑定。使用流程如下,先定义一个storeVue.use(Vuex)const store = new Vuex.Store({ state: { count: 0 }, mutations: { increment (state) { state.count++ }, decr...
原创
2021-07-14 11:43:32
166阅读
【代码】vue vuex mapGetters。
原创
2023-09-23 11:14:39
73阅读